GOAL TEAM PLAN
- All remaining meetings will be “grade level meetings” (with next year’s team).
- With your grade level team, complete your second PBL Unit Plan (link to the common district unit plan that you are expected to use is here: Unit Plan) by April 15th. This unit should be planned (to teach next year...). You will only be accountable for "planning" a second unit plan-teaching it this year is optional.
- Evaluate your plan using the: Project Design Rubric
- April 15th: Each grade level will share their completed unit plan (and evaluation)
- Information: Previous presentations will be at the PBL button above on Canvas, just in case you need a refresher.
- Austin Rutledge will be here on Friday, March 18th during your grade level plan time. Please plan to utilize Austin as a resource-come with all/any questions you have about PBL & your specific Unit Plan. This will count as our GLTM's for March.
- Innovation Team will be attending a conference in February to support our growth in PBL. Knowledge will be shared with all staff upon our return.

Guided Math/Math Workshop Resources Available NOW!!
The Title I Guided Math page and additional Numeracy Support Resources are now available for all SPS Teachers on Glass Classroom!
You will find:
· Video and photo examples of all components of the Guided Math Instructional Configuration
· Video of SPS teachers answering “Why Guided Math?” and their tips for how to get started
· Examples of mini-lessons, small group lesson formats, conferencing, management and station rotation tips K - 5
· Numerous Apps and differentiated station activities
